Quote:
Originally Posted by teaser
A problem with measuring hydration by ketone reading is that yOur ketone reading can be quite high without you being dehydrated. Hydration, level of ketones in the blood, and level of reabsorption by the kidneys are the main factors. I have also seen the idea around that as we become ketone and fat adapted, ketones disappear,sometimes put in terms of us using the ketones instead of spilling them. This is truthy, certainly if we absorb them less are wasted, more burned, but we burn them because they are available, not having been spilled, rather than them not being there to waste due to being burned. From the idea that adapted people spill less ketones sometimes I see people worried that showing ketones means they are not well adapted, that is just one more false conclusion that cannot be supported by a urine ketone reading.
